Because of its low solubility in water and high thermal stability, thorium phosphate diphosphate (TPD), Th-4(PO4)(4)P2O7, seems to be a very good matrix for radionuclide immobilization, During the leaching studies of this compound the formation of a new phase, different from the TPD was observed. In order to identify this phase, two other thorium phosphates: thorium phosphate-hydrogenphosphate (TPHP), Th-2(PO4)(2)HPO4.H2O, and thorium hydroxide phosphate (THOP), Th(OH)PO4, were synthesized in hydrothermal conditions then characterized. It appeared that the neoformed phase was identical to the TPHP. (C) 2001 Academic Press.
